Northrop Grumman Aeronautics Systems sector has an opening for a Production Test Engineering Manager 2 to join our team of qualified, diverse individuals within our Test and Evaluation organization. This leadership role is located in Palmdale, CA.

Responsibilities include & are not limited to:

  • Lead a team of 10-20 production test engineers.

  • Cross IPT coordination with many supporting organizations.

  • Technical experience to lead their team to perform, solve complex issues, and knock down obstacles to allow their team to execute efficiently.

  • Ensure that the team is developing and conducting safe and effective test procedures.

  • Leading a team in the development and refinement of acceptance test procedures.

  • Participate in and/or chair Post Test Data reviews.

In this role, the manager will be responsible for program execution as well as people leadership. The candidate should have a desire to lead and value people.
